What Are Inlays & Onlays?

Inlays and onlays are custom-made restorations used to repair teeth that are too damaged for a filling but not damaged enough to require a full crown. They are made from durable materials such as porcelain, composite resin, or gold, and are bonded to the surface of the tooth. An inlay fits within the grooves of the tooth, while an onlay extends over one or more of the tooth’s cusps. Both options are designed to restore the function, strength, and appearance of your tooth.

How Do Inlays & Onlays Help, and What Are Their Benefits?

Inlays and onlays provide an excellent solution for repairing moderately damaged or decayed teeth while preserving as much of the natural tooth structure as possible. They strengthen the tooth and prevent further damage.

Benefits of Inlays & Onlays:

Inlays and onlays offer a conservative and durable solution for restoring damaged teeth while maintaining their natural beauty. Here are their key benefits:

Custom Fit

Crafted to fit your tooth precisely, inlays and onlays provide optimal comfort and a secure fit.

Tooth Preservation

Unlike crowns, they require less removal of the natural tooth structure, preserving more of your healthy tooth.

Durable and Strong

Made from high-quality materials, inlays and onlays are designed to withstand daily wear and tear, offering long-lasting durability.

Seamless Appearance

These restorations are color-matched to blend naturally with your teeth, enhancing your smile without being noticeable.

Protects from Decay

By covering and sealing damaged areas, they prevent further decay and protect the tooth from additional harm.

How Is the Inlay & Onlay Procedure at Perfect Smile of South Florida?

At Perfect Smile of South Florida, the inlay and onlay procedure is tailored for precision and comfort. The process usually requires two visits.

During the first visit, the damaged area of the tooth is carefully removed, and an impression of the tooth is taken. This impression is sent to a dental lab to create a custom inlay or onlay that fits perfectly. A temporary filling is placed to protect the tooth in the meantime.

At the second visit, the custom restoration is bonded securely to your tooth using advanced dental adhesives. The inlay or onlay is then polished to ensure it blends naturally with your smile and fits comfortably with your bite.

How long do inlays and onlays last?

Inlays and onlays are extremely durable and can last 10 to 20 years or longer with proper care and regular dental visits.
